Westerton hut circle and field system is a post-medieval settlement complex located north-northwest of Westerton in Kincardineshire, Scotland. The site comprises the remains of a hut circle associated with an organized field system, representing the agricultural landscape of the early modern period in northeast Scotland. The physical evidence suggests a small pastoral holding typical of the dispersed settlement pattern characteristic of post-medieval rural Kincardineshire, where such individual farmsteads and associated cultivation areas were common features of the regional economy.
